On June 29, the People's Daily published an article by Jin Sheping titled "Achieving High-Quality Development by Breaking Free from the 'Rat Race' Competition," which specifically mentioned the "rat race" competition in PV modules, NEVs, and energy storage systems. The article pointed out that currently, some industries in China are facing the dilemma of "rat race" competition. The price of PV modules has dropped to 0.6 yuan per watt, over a hundred automakers in the NEV industry have been caught up in a price war, and the winning bids for energy storage systems have repeatedly hit new lows. This disorderly low-price competition has severely impacted the healthy development of the industry: corporate profit margins continue to decline; R&D investment is forced to be cut, resulting in insufficient innovation momentum; and the industry chain ecosystem has deteriorated, with significant pressure on upstream and downstream enterprises. The reasons for this are as follows: First, there is a supply-demand imbalance in the market, with severe overcapacity in some industries; second, local protectionism has led to market fragmentation, with some regions still blindly attracting investment; third, the standard system is imperfect, providing room for low-price and low-quality competition. This vicious competition not only distorts market mechanisms but also hinders high-quality economic development.
